HarborCrest Behavioral Health: Comprehensive Addiction Treatment in Aberdeen, WA
HarborCrest Behavioral Health, part of Harbor Regional Health Community Hospital in Aberdeen, WA, is a dedicated facility offering comprehensive care for individuals struggling with substance use disorders and co-occurring mental health conditions. Located at 1006 North H Street, this center provides a spectrum of evidence-based services designed to meet patients wherever they are on their recovery journey, emphasizing personalized and compassionate treatment for sustainable healing.
Integrated Treatment Approach
The core philosophy at HarborCrest centers on treating both addiction and any co-occurring mental health issues simultaneously, known as dual diagnosis treatment. This integrated approach ensures that all aspects of a patient’s well-being are addressed, leading to more comprehensive and effective long-term recovery. Treatment plans are tailored to individual clinical needs and personal goals, utilizing a variety of therapeutic modalities.
Program Offerings and Levels of Care
HarborCrest provides multiple levels of care, ensuring continuity from crisis stabilization through long-term recovery support:
- Inpatient Medical Detoxification: Medically managed withdrawal management services are provided in a hospital setting with 24-hour nursing and physician supervision, offering safety and stability during the critical detox phase.
- Hospital Inpatient Treatment: High-level residential care focused on stabilization and treatment engagement, with daily clinical reviews and access to medical professionals.
- Outpatient Services: This flexible option includes the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P), structured aftercare services, and various substance use disorder assessments, including those required for legal or protective services.
- Medication Options: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) is discussed collaboratively with patients upon admission to ensure treatment decisions align with informed choice and clinical necessity.
Specialized Services and Accessibility
In addition to general addiction treatment, the center offers specialized services, such as Perinatal Mental Health and Trauma treatment. HarborCrest is committed to accessibility, offering services like the Alcohol and Drug Information School. They accept numerous insurance carriers for their inpatient medical detox program, including Aetna, Blue Cross Blue Shield, Cigna, First Choice, Lifewise, Medicare, and certain Medicaid plans (Amerigroup and Molina).
Frequently Asked Questions
Is HarborCrest only for substance use disorders?
No. HarborCrest is a dual diagnosis treatment center that specializes in treating both substance use disorders and co-occurring mental health conditions simultaneously for comprehensive recovery.
What types of assessments are available?
The facility offers various Substance Use Disorder assessments, including DUI evaluations and court-ordered or Child Protective Services–requested evaluations.
Does HarborCrest offer treatment using medication?
Yes, medication options are discussed collaboratively at the time of admission, including medication-assisted treatment (MAT), to align with the individual’s clinical needs and personal goals.
